What is the Multi-Modular Approach?
The multi-modular approach in hypnotherapy training London contains combining multiple therapeutic techniques within a structured framework. This method allows therapists to tailor their interventions to meet the specific needs of each client. The approach typically includes modules on traditional hypnotherapy, cognitive-behavioural techniques, mindfulness, and other therapeutic practices. By integrating these diverse techniques, therapists can address a broader spectrum of issues, from anxiety and stress to behavioural problems and chronic pain.
Core Components of the Multi-Modular Approach
- Traditional Hypnotherapy: This module focuses on guiding clients into a state of deep relaxation and heightened suggestibility. Clients can access their subconscious mind, which helps uncover and address deep-rooted issues that might not be apparent through conventional talk therapy In this state. Techniques such as progressive relaxation, imagery, and suggestion therapy are commonly used.
- Cognitive-Behavioural Techniques (CBT): CBT is integrated into hypnotherapy to help clients identify and change negative thought patterns and behaviours. This module teaches therapists how to combine cognitive restructuring with hypnotherapy, making it easier for clients to adopt healthier thought patterns and behaviours.
- Mindfulness and Relaxation: This module incorporates mindfulness practices into hypnotherapy. Mindfulness helps clients become more aware of their thoughts and feelings without judgment, which can enhance the effectiveness of hypnotherapy. Techniques such as guided imagery, deep breathing, and body scanning are used to promote relaxation and self-awareness.
- Behavioural Variation: This module focuses on using hypnotherapy to help clients change undesirable behaviours. Techniques such as aversion therapy, positive reinforcement, and habit reversal are integrated into hypnotherapy sessions to help clients develop healthier behaviours.
- Specific Techniques: The multi-modular approach also includes specialised techniques for addressing specific issues such as phobias, trauma, and chronic pain. These techniques are tailored to meet the unique needs of each client, ensuring a personalised treatment plan.
